view more2023223 · Both cone crushers and gyratory crushers have a variety of applications in the mining industry. Cone crushers are commonly used for secondary and tertiary crushing stages in the aggregate and mining industries, where they are used to produce smaller sizes of rock. view more202475 · Cone crushers are highly effective at using compression to crush material into a consistent product. For this reason, cone crushers are the most commonly used crushing plant for secondary and tertiary crushing stages in both the aggregate and recycling industries. view more202387 · MCC Cone Crusher There are generally four types of Standard Cone Crushers: the MCC Standard or Coarse type, the MCF Fine or Medium type, the MCS Short Head type & MCSS Super Fine type. All four types are designed for secondary or tertiary crushing purposes both in stationary and portable applications for highly abrasive materials.
